Partager via


macro ListView_DeleteColumn (commctrl.h)

Supprime une colonne d’un contrôle d’affichage de liste. Vous pouvez utiliser cette macro ou envoyer le message LVM_DELETECOLUMN explicitement.

Syntaxe

void ListView_DeleteColumn(
   hwnd,
   iCol
);

Paramètres

hwnd

Type : HWND

Handle pour le contrôle d’affichage de liste.

iCol

Type : int

Index de la colonne à supprimer.

Valeur de retour

None

Remarques

La suppression de la colonne zéro d’un contrôle list-view n’est prise en charge que dans ComCtl32.dll version 6 et ultérieures. La version 5 prend également en charge la suppression de la colonne zéro, mais uniquement après avoir utilisé CCM_SETVERSION pour définir la version sur 5 ou une version ultérieure. Dans les versions antérieures à la version 5, si vous devez supprimer la colonne zéro, insérez une colonne factice de longueur zéro et supprimez la colonne 1 et les colonnes supérieures.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ows Vista [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2003 [applications de bureau uniquement]
Plateforme cible Windows
En-tête commctrl.h